在信息技术迅猛发展的今天,软件行业的专业性和技术性要求日益提高,这也使得软件行业的从业人员需要不断提升自己的专业技能和知识水平。软考(软件水平考试)作为国内软件行业最具权威性的专业认证之一,其考试内容涵盖了软件工程的各个方面,其中合同的内容也是软考中不可忽视的一部分。

在软件开发项目中,合同是项目各方之间权利和义务的法律约束,也是项目管理的重要依据。因此,在软考中,对于合同内容的理解和掌握,对于软件工程师来说至关重要。

首先,合同的基本要素是软考中必须掌握的内容。一份完整的合同通常包括合同双方的基本信息、合同项目的名称和描述、项目的交付物和时间表、项目的价格和支付方式、保密和知识产权条款、违约责任和解决争议的方式等。在软考中,考生需要熟悉这些基本要素,并能够根据具体情况进行灵活应用。

其次,合同中关于需求变更的条款也是软考中经常涉及的内容。在软件开发过程中,需求变更是不可避免的。因此,合同中需要明确需求变更的处理方式和流程,包括变更请求的提出、审批和实施等。这对于保证项目的顺利进行和避免合同纠纷具有重要意义。

此外,合同中关于验收标准和程序的条款也是软考中的重点内容。软件开发完成后,需要进行验收以确保项目交付物符合合同约定的要求。合同中应明确验收的标准和程序,包括验收测试的内容和方法、验收通过的条件和流程等。这对于保证项目质量和维护双方利益具有重要作用。

除了以上几点,软考中还可能涉及合同中关于质量保证和售后服务的条款。软件开发项目的质量保证是项目成功的关键因素之一。合同中应明确质量保证的具体措施和标准,以及售后服务的内容和范围。这对于提高客户满意度和维护企业形象具有重要作用。

在软考中,对于合同内容的掌握不仅仅停留在理论层面,更需要考生具备实际应用的能力。例如,在案例分析题中,考生需要根据给定的项目背景和合同内容,分析项目中可能存在的问题和风险,并提出合理的解决方案和建议。这需要考生具备扎实的理论基础和丰富的实践经验。

总之,软考中合同的内容是软件工程师必须掌握的重要知识点之一。通过深入学习和理解合同的基本要素、需求变更条款、验收标准和程序以及质量保证和售后服务条款等内容,考生可以更好地应对软考中的相关问题,并在实际工作中更好地运用合同知识来保障项目的顺利进行和维护各方利益。同时,随着软件行业的不断发展和变化,软考的内容和要求也在不断更新和完善。因此,软件工程师需要保持持续学习和进步的态度,不断提升自己的专业素养和综合能力,以适应行业发展的需要。